Maximilian Mittelstädt has been the standout performer for VfB Stuttgart in league play this season with a rating of 7.53. Deniz Undav and Angelo Stiller have also impressed with ratings of 7.45 and 7.31 respectively.

Deniz Undav leads VfB Stuttgart's scoring in league play with 18 goals this season. Ermedin Demirovic has contributed 10, while Jamie Leweling has added 7.

Jamie Leweling is the chief creator for VfB Stuttgart in league play with 7 assists this season. Chris Führich and Angelo Stiller have also been key playmakers with 6 and 5 assists respectively.

VfB Stuttgart have been in mixed form recently, winning 2 of their last 5 matches (40% win rate). They have scored 9 goals and conceded 8 during this period. Overall, they have shown good attacking threat. In the Bundesliga, they faced a 0-2 loss to Borussia Dortmund, a 4-0 win against Hamburger SV, a 2-4 loss to Bayern München, and a 1-1 draw with Werder Bremen. In the DFB Pokal, they faced a 2-1 win against Freiburg.

Looking ahead, VfB Stuttgart have 1 home game and 3 away fixtures in their next 4 matches. Upcoming opponents: Hoffenheim (away), Leverkusen (home), Frankfurt (away), and Bayern München (away).

VfB Stuttgart currently sits in 4th place in the Bundesliga with 57 points from 31 matches (17W 6D 8L).

VfB Stuttgart's squad consists of 26 players. Goalkeepers: Fabian Bredlow (Germany), Stefan Drljaca (Germany), Alexander Nübel (Germany), Florian Hellstern (Germany). Defenders: Ameen Al Dakhil (Belgium), Ramon Hendriks (Netherlands), Josha Vagnoman (Germany), Maximilian Mittelstädt (Germany), Luca Jaquez (Switzerland), Pascal Stenzel (Germany), Lorenz Assignon (France), Dan-Axel Zagadou (France), Jeff Chabot (Germany), Finn Jeltsch (Germany). Midfielders: Angelo Stiller (Germany), Bilal El Khannouss (Morocco), Atakan Karazor (Turkiye), Chema Andres (Spain), Mirza Catovic (Serbia), Lazar Jovanovic (Serbia). Forwards: Tiago Tomás (Portugal), Ermedin Demirovic (Bosnia and Herzegovina), Chris Führich (Germany), Jamie Leweling (Germany), Deniz Undav (Germany), Badredine Bouanani (Algeria).

VfB Stuttgart transfers: New signings include Jeremy Arevalo (from Racing Santander), Bilal El Khannouss (from Leicester), Badredine Bouanani (from Nice), Tiago Tomás (from Wolfsburg), Chema Andres (from Real Madrid) and 3 more. Players transferred out include Leonidas Stergiou (to FC Heidenheim), Jovan Milosevic (to Werder Bremen), Silas Katompa Mvumpa (to Mainz), Yannik Keitel (to Augsburg), Nick Woltemade (to Newcastle) and 12 more.

Sebastian Hoeneß is the current head coach of VfB Stuttgart. Under their leadership, the team has achieved a 53% win rate across 107 matches, averaging 1.80 points per game.

Notable previous managers include Bruno Labbadia managed the club for 3 seasons, recording 13 wins from 48 matches (27% win rate). Pellegrino Matarazzo managed the club for 4 seasons, recording 27 wins from 93 matches (29% win rate). Other former coaches include Michael Wimmer, Tim Walter, Tayfun Korkut, Markus Weinzierl, Nico Willig, Hannes Wolf, Jos Luhukay, Olaf Janßen, Alexander Zorniger, and Huub Stevens.

VfB Stuttgart plays their home matches at MHPArena in Stuttgart, which has a capacity of 60,469.
